Travellers to Singapore must wear monitoring device if serving SHN at home

Fiona Lam
Published Mon, Aug 3, 2020 · 09:50 PM

Singapore

ALL incoming travellers serving their stay-home notice (SHN) outside of dedicated facilities must soon wear an electronic monitoring device, Singapore authorities announced on Monday.

From Aug 10, 11.59pm, these travellers - including returning residents, long-term pass holders, work pass holders and their dependents - will need to don the device throughout the 14-day SHN. Those aged 12 and below will be exempted from this requirement.
